Corsi on-line

Redirezionare gli utenti che navigano con iPad con un .htaccess

In questo breve post vedremo come realizzare un semplice file .hataccess in grado di rilevare se la navigazione su un sito Web viene effettuata tramite il tablet iPad; fortunatamente il noto dispositivo della Casa di Cupertino dispone di uno schermo abbastanza ampio e può contare su un browser efficiente, difficilmente quindi una pagina Web non sarà visibile tramite l’iPad.

Nei casi in cui si voglia, comunque, mettere a disposizione degli internauti una versione del proprio sito Web ottimizzata per la “tavoletta delle meraviglie” sarà sufficiente uploadare sul proprio spazio hosting un file .htaccess contenente un codice come il seguente:

RewriteCond %{HTTP_USER_AGENT} ^.*iPad.*$
RewriteRule ^(.*)$ http://tablet.nomesito.it [R=301]

Il codice intercetta attraverso l’HTTP_USER_AGENT il dispositivo utilizzato per la navigazione, se questo è un iPad richiama il modulo per il rewrite e determina un redirect 301 (quindi definitivo) verso la versione del sito appositamente confezionata per l’iPad.

Post correlati
  • Articolo davvero molto utile!
    Una domanda: come si fa ad indirizzare verso il sito normale gli utenti che visitano con un browser normale il sito mobile?

I più letti del mese
Tematiche